Are Bullion Sales Taxed in Kentucky?
In Kentucky, precious metals transactions are subject to the standard sales tax rate.
Kentucky imposes a 6% sales tax on all purchases, including those of bullion and precious metal coins. This means that any transactions involving gold, silver, or other precious metals in Kentucky are liable for this tax rate, without any specific exemptions.
For those seeking more detailed information about taxation on gold and silver sales in Kentucky, it is advisable to consult the state’s official tax regulations or a tax professional for the most current guidelines.
